Aluminum oxide mediated C-F bond activation in trifluoromethylated arenes

Thermally activated gamma-aluminium oxide was found to be very effective for C-F bond activation in trifluoromethylated arenes. Depending on the activation degree the respective arenes can be converted either to cyclic ketones or to the respective carboxylic acids with good to excellent yields.
